Output e4fabaabbe3f1adfda37791f6a45865c66a43c702c02f7d23163d220cb1c20d8:1

value
109140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12899fe0275e18d2fd177a6cfb629325c028ebfc OP_EQUAL
address
33P2xKFraeVW4xuP3TLitr1MYoo5s6tycG
transaction
e4fabaabbe3f1adfda37791f6a45865c66a43c702c02f7d23163d220cb1c20d8
spent
true